Why India’s Engineering Output Isn’t Translating into Innovation

India is graduating over 1.5 million engineers every year — more than nearly any other country. But despite this vast technical talent, the nation still faces a major gap: turning engineers into innovators. There are concerns about low employability, outdated curricula, and a mismatch between what the industry demands and what colleges teach.

Only about 42‑46% of engineering graduates are considered job‑ready in emerging sectors like AI, robotics, or clean technologies. Many students feel unprepared when they enter the workforce. At the same time, the rapid pace of technological change has made traditional technical skills insufficient. To keep up, a large majority of engineering students are now trying to upskill.

India’s higher education system is under pressure to modernize. Improvements suggested include stronger collaboration between academia and industry, updating course content, promoting interdisciplinary learning, and encouraging more research and development. If such reforms are implemented, the country could leverage its engineering output to become a global leader in innovation, not just engineering numbers.
